CRISPR-Based Microbial Engineering Business Landscape Review

Segments
- By Product Type: The market can be segmented into plasmids and vectors, synthetic DNA, genomic DNA, RNA, enzymes, and others. Plasmids and vectors hold a significant share in the market due to their essential role in carrying and delivering CRISPR components to microbial cells.
- By Application: Segmentation based on application includes research, agriculture, industrial biotechnology, healthcare, and others. The agriculture segment is expected to witness substantial growth due to the increasing demand for genetically modified crops and sustainable farming practices.
- By End-User: End-users in the market include pharmaceutical and biotechnology companies, academic and research institutes, contract research organizations, and others. The pharmaceutical and biotechnology companies segment is projected to dominate the market share as CRISPR-based microbial engineering plays a crucial role in drug discovery and development processes.
